Abstract: | Thermal decomposition of FeSO4-H2O in carbon monoxide has been studied up to 900°C by thermoanalytical methods and the reaction products and intermediates identified by Mössbauer, IR and X-ray diffraction techniques. The main reaction products are elemental iron and ferrous sulphide; at higher temperatures, cementite is formed as well. For comparison, experiments have also been carried out in hydrogen atmosphere. |
